It can be tricky to do without damaging the receiver but if you don't care about the receiver just put it in a bench vise (clamping on the trunnion) and use a big wrench with an extension arm to unthread the barrel. A little heat on the trunnion can help but only a little. If you want to save the receiver you will need to make up some sort of trunnion block/receiver protector. I used a cut length of grade 8 bolt and some aluminum to support and protect the receiver at the trunnion when I changed the barrel on my old PE90. Do not put any clamping force on the receiver body, only the trunnion.
